GNTX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2025 in Review

482 of the 7,595 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Gentex (GNTX) for Q2 2025, worth a combined $4.78B — down 6.9% from $5.14B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 86 funds closed out of GNTX and 55 opened new positions — a net loss of 31 holders — while 178 trimmed existing stakes and 193 added.

The largest buyer was Fuller & Thaler Asset Management, adding an estimated $73.1M. The largest seller was Beutel, Goodman & Co, exiting entirely with an estimated $141M sold.
